Web11 aug. 2024 · Medications such as gabapentin (Gralise, Neurontin, Horizant) and pregabalin (Lyrica), developed to treat epilepsy, may relieve nerve pain. Side effects can include drowsiness and dizziness. Topical treatments. Capsaicin cream, which contains a substance found in hot peppers, can cause modest improvements in peripheral …

Web6 jan. 2024 · Paraesthesia is a condition characterized by an abnormal sensation, such as numbness, tingling, or burning. It can affect any area of the body. Causes, Symptoms, … Web25 feb. 2024 · paresthesia ( countable and uncountable, plural paresthesias or paresthesiae ) A sensation of burning, prickling, itching, or tingling of the skin, with no obvious cause . Paresthesia occurs when a body part 'falls asleep'.
